#2bad36 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2bad36 is composed of 16.9% red, 67.8% green and 21.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 68.8% yellow and 32.2% black. It has a hue angle of 125.1 degrees, a saturation of 60.2% and a lightness of 42.4%. #2bad36 color hex could be obtained by blending #56ff6c with #005b00.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

● #2bad36 color description : Dark lime green.
#2bad36 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2bad36 has RGB values of R:43, G:173, B:54 and CMYK values of C:0.75, M:0, Y:0.69, K:0.32. Its decimal value is 2862390.

Shades and Tints of #2bad36
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#effbf0 is the lightest one.

Tones of #2bad36
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#657366 is the less saturated color, while #01d713 is the most saturated one.
